◉ Newton's Second Law
Answer: The acceleration of a body due to a force will be in the same
direction as the force, with a magnitude inversely proportional to its
mass.
(Usually written F=ma, Force= mass x acceleration)
◉ Newton's Third Law
Answer: For every action, there is an equal and opposite reaction
◉ Newton's Law of Universal Gravitation
Answer: This law gives the force of gravity between any two objects
in the Universe. The force of gravity is proportional to (mass of
object 1) × (mass of object 2) divided by the distance between the
two objects squared:
◉ Strength of force equation
,Answer: Fg = G (m1 m2)/r2
◉ More mass=more gravity
Answer: If the mass of a planet were twice that of another, but they
had the same radius, the gravity felt on the surface of the more-
massive one would be twice as strong
◉ Large separation=less gravity
Answer: If the radius of a planet were twice that of another, the
gravity is 1/(2)2= 1/4 as strong
◉ Gravitational Force
Answer: Directly proportional to the mass of each interacting object
and inversely proportional to the distance between them squared
